Betty's Soul and Seafood has been inspected three times since 2022. The most recent report on file is from May 15, 2025. Low risk means the most recent visit produced few or no significant findings.

Recent inspections have turned up roughly the same number of issues each time, hovering near two violations per visit.

Among Palatka restaurants, the typical score is 75; Betty's Soul and Seafood is comfortably above that bar. The full picture is one of consistent compliance.

Inspection History
May 15, 2025
Routine - Food
1 major violation. 1 minor violation.
View 2 violations
Intermediate - Spray bottle containing toxic substance not labeled. Chemical spray bottle of bleach missing label.
41-17-4
Basic - No Heimlich maneuver/choking sign posted. No choking poster available. Inspector provided. **Corrective Action Taken**
51-13-4
86
May 24, 2024
Routine - Food
1 minor violation.
View 1 violation
Basic - Mobile food dispensing vehicle license number not permanently affixed on the side of the unit in figures at least 2 inches high and in contrasting colors from the background of the vehicle. Incorrect license number on the outside of the unit. Correct license number 6450116.
50-04-4
95
Aug 4, 2022
Routine - Food
1 major violation.
View 1 violation
Intermediate - No sanitizer of any kind available for warewashing. Only use single-service items to serve food to customers until sanitizer is available for warewashing. No sanitizer available during inspection. Operator utilizes bleach.
22-38-5
90
